Orban asks Putin for immediate Ukraine ceasefire

Hungary’s Prime Minister Viktor Orban said he asked Russian President Vladimir Putin to call an immediate cease-fire in the conflict in Ukraine and that his country will follow with Russian demands to pay for natural gas imports in rubles.
Orban said he also offered to host a conference in Hungary's capital with the warring parties and the leaders of France and Germany to work out the cease-fire terms.Orban spoke at a news conference days after his party won a fourth consecutive term leading the Hungarian government.Hungary is a member of both the European Union and NATO.
